Driving Forces: What's Propelling the Racing Car Motors

Several key factors are driving the growth of the racing car motors market. Firstly, the ever-increasing popularity of motorsport events worldwide fuels the demand for high-performance engines and related technologies. The global reach of Formula 1, IndyCar, and other racing series creates a massive audience and generates significant interest in the underlying technology. Secondly, continuous advancements in materials science and engineering are resulting in lighter, more powerful, and more efficient engines. The adoption of advanced materials such as carbon fiber composites and the use of sophisticated manufacturing techniques contribute to improved performance and reduced weight. Thirdly, the growing integration of electronics and data analytics allows for real-time monitoring and optimization of engine performance. This enables teams to fine-tune their engines for optimal performance under various conditions. Finally, the rising demand for high-performance vehicles among affluent consumers further stimulates the market for racing car motors. These high-performance engines often find their way into limited-edition road cars, creating a spillover effect from the racing world to the consumer market. The demand for bespoke and customized engines for high-end automobiles also plays a significant role in this growth.

Challenges and Restraints in Racing Car Motors

Despite the positive growth outlook, the racing car motors market faces several challenges. Stringent environmental regulations, particularly regarding emissions, are placing significant pressure on manufacturers to develop cleaner and more sustainable engines. This requires substantial investments in research and development, potentially hindering profitability. The high cost of development and manufacturing of racing car motors also presents a barrier to entry for new players, resulting in a concentrated market dominated by established manufacturers. Furthermore, the economic volatility and uncertainty within the global economy can impact the demand for high-performance vehicles, especially in luxury segments. Fluctuations in fuel prices also play a role, impacting the overall cost of racing and influencing the design choices of racing engines. Maintaining the balance between performance and environmental responsibility is a significant challenge, requiring manufacturers to find innovative solutions to comply with increasingly stringent regulations. The increasing cost of materials and the complexity of manufacturing processes also add to the overall cost, potentially impacting market profitability.

Key Region or Country & Segment to Dominate the Market

  • Europe: Europe, particularly countries like Germany, Italy, and the UK, have historically been major players in the racing car motors market, owing to a strong presence of high-performance automotive manufacturers and a rich history of motorsport. This region is expected to remain a dominant market segment due to substantial investments in research & development and a significant consumer base for high-performance vehicles.

  • North America: The significant popularity of motorsports like NASCAR and IndyCar, coupled with a strong demand for luxury and high-performance vehicles, positions North America as another key region. The presence of major automotive manufacturers and a thriving aftermarket further contribute to its market dominance.

  • Asia-Pacific: While currently exhibiting lower market share compared to Europe and North America, the Asia-Pacific region is expected to witness significant growth in the coming years. This is driven by the rising disposable income and a growing interest in motorsports across countries like China and Japan. This expansion will be mainly supported by an increase in high-performance vehicle sales, particularly in the luxury car segment.

  • Segment Dominance: The segment of high-performance internal combustion engines (ICE) is projected to maintain its significant market share in the near future, despite the growing importance of hybrid and electric powertrains. This is due to the continued dominance of ICE in many racing series and the performance advantages they currently offer. However, the hybrid and electric powertrain segments are anticipated to grow rapidly in the long term, driven by advancements in battery technology and increasing pressure for environmentally friendly alternatives.
